On July 1, 1944, the Department of Parks and Recreation was created by ordinance and all functions were merged into this new Department. The County of Los Angeles Department of Parks and Recreation has a long, proud history which has brought us to where we are today. Event Details Let's Discover STEM East Las Vegas Community Center Let's Discover S.T.E.M. is a seven-week, parenting program focusing on science, technology, engineering, and math designed for families with preschool-aged children featuring reading and hands-on learning activities. Prior to becoming the Department of Parks and Recreation, operations and facilities were managed by 1) the Parks Division, which was responsible for maintaining all physical aspects of parks under the Forester and Fire Wardens Office, and 2) the Department of Recreation, Camps and Playgrounds which was responsible for administering all park programs.
